Why You Should Hire an Asbestos Attorney

An asbestos lawyer can assist you to obtain compensation for medical expenses and other losses due to asbestos exposure. They may also file a asbestos lawsuit against the companies who exposed you to this hazardous mineral.

Asbestos litigation is highly specialized. A skilled attorney can defend your rights against large corporations and make sure you get an equitable settlement.

Asbestos is a mineral that occurs naturally that was sought-after for its durability, fire-resistant properties and low price. It was used in the production of thousands of products throughout the 20th century. Production increased after WWII as wartime demand grew. Unfortunately, the harmful fibers were linked to a broad range of illnesses that included mesothelioma and lung cancer and asbestosis.

Getting the Compensation You Need

Your lawyer can assist you should you or a family member has developed mesothelioma, or lung cancer following being exposed to asbestos. A successful claim can be used to pay for medical bills and lost income, as well as out-of-pocket expenses as well as pain and suffering, among other losses.

A knowledgeable asbestos lawyer will determine the most appropriate state to file a lawsuit and will make sure your lawsuit is filed in time, so you do not miss out on the money you deserve. In some states the statute of limitations is only two or three years.

You could be eligible to receive compensation from the Department of Veterans Affairs and trust funds, in addition to bringing a lawsuit against asbestos companies responsible for your exposure. Your lawyer can explain your legal options and offer you the best advice about what to pursue.

Mesothelioma compensation from a lawsuit, trust fund or VA claim can help the victims and their families pay the cost of treatment and other expenses. It's also intended to create a sense of accountability and justice to those responsible for asbestos legal exposure.
